SPC — rigid stone-composite planks with a click-lock join, 5–6.5mm thick. Best suited to conservatories, utility rooms and any subfloor that isn't perfectly level. Warranty: 20 year residential warranty.

- Genuine waterproof surface and joint
- Click-lock system — floats over a slightly imperfect base
- Pre-bonded underlay pad on the plank back
